版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
敏捷開發(fā)實(shí)戰(zhàn)指南:Scrum、Kanban等方法詳解引言敏捷開發(fā)作為現(xiàn)代軟件開發(fā)的核心方法論之一,已經(jīng)在全球范圍內(nèi)得到廣泛應(yīng)用。Scrum和Kanban作為兩種最具代表性的敏捷框架,各自擁有獨(dú)特的理論體系和實(shí)踐方法。本文將深入探討Scrum和Kanban的基本概念、核心實(shí)踐、適用場(chǎng)景及實(shí)施要點(diǎn),幫助讀者全面理解這兩種敏捷方法,并在實(shí)際工作中靈活運(yùn)用。Scrum框架詳解Scrum的基本概念Scrum是一種迭代式、增量的軟件開發(fā)框架,由JeffSutherland和KenSchwaber在2001年正式提出。它遵循《Scrum指南》中的定義,將產(chǎn)品開發(fā)劃分為一系列固定時(shí)間(通常為2-4周)的Sprint周期。每個(gè)Sprint結(jié)束時(shí),團(tuán)隊(duì)交付一個(gè)潛在可發(fā)布的產(chǎn)品增量,并從反饋中學(xué)習(xí)和調(diào)整。Scrum的核心角色包括:1.產(chǎn)品負(fù)責(zé)人(ProductOwner):負(fù)責(zé)定義產(chǎn)品愿景,管理產(chǎn)品待辦事項(xiàng)列表(ProductBacklog)2.敏捷教練(ScrumMaster):引導(dǎo)團(tuán)隊(duì)實(shí)踐Scrum,移除障礙3.開發(fā)團(tuán)隊(duì)(DevelopmentTeam):自組織、跨職能的跨專業(yè)團(tuán)隊(duì)Scrum的核心實(shí)踐Sprint周期Sprint是Scrum的基本工作單元,每個(gè)Sprint有明確的時(shí)間盒(通常為1-4周)。Sprint開始時(shí),團(tuán)隊(duì)從產(chǎn)品待辦事項(xiàng)列表中選取優(yōu)先級(jí)最高的需求,制定本次Sprint的目標(biāo)和計(jì)劃。Sprint期間,團(tuán)隊(duì)每天舉行15分鐘的站會(huì),討論進(jìn)展、識(shí)別障礙。Sprint結(jié)束時(shí),團(tuán)隊(duì)進(jìn)行評(píng)審會(huì)展示成果,并收集反饋;隨后進(jìn)行回顧會(huì),總結(jié)經(jīng)驗(yàn)教訓(xùn)。產(chǎn)品待辦事項(xiàng)管理產(chǎn)品待辦事項(xiàng)列表是Scrum的核心,包含所有需要完成的工作項(xiàng)。產(chǎn)品負(fù)責(zé)人負(fù)責(zé)維護(hù)列表的排序,確保最高優(yōu)先級(jí)的需求排在前面。列表項(xiàng)通常以用戶故事、任務(wù)或需求的形式存在,并附帶詳細(xì)描述、驗(yàn)收標(biāo)準(zhǔn)和估算值。在Sprint計(jì)劃會(huì)中,團(tuán)隊(duì)根據(jù)Sprint容量選擇合適的工作項(xiàng)。事件體系Scrum定義了6個(gè)重要事件:1.Sprint計(jì)劃會(huì):確定Sprint目標(biāo)和計(jì)劃2.每日站會(huì):快速同步進(jìn)展和問題3.Sprint評(píng)審會(huì):展示成果并收集反饋4.Sprint回顧會(huì):總結(jié)經(jīng)驗(yàn)教訓(xùn)5.Sprint沖刺:執(zhí)行開發(fā)工作6.產(chǎn)品待辦事項(xiàng)細(xì)化會(huì):在Sprint之間補(bǔ)充和細(xì)化需求看板可視化雖然看板是另一種敏捷方法,但在Scrum實(shí)踐中常被用作可視化工具。開發(fā)團(tuán)隊(duì)通過看板展示SprintBacklog中的任務(wù)狀態(tài),從"待辦"到"進(jìn)行中"再到"完成",幫助團(tuán)隊(duì)透明化管理工作流,識(shí)別瓶頸。Scrum的優(yōu)勢(shì)與挑戰(zhàn)優(yōu)勢(shì):-強(qiáng)調(diào)迭代和反饋,降低項(xiàng)目風(fēng)險(xiǎn)-自組織和跨職能團(tuán)隊(duì)提升效率-明確的角色和事件促進(jìn)協(xié)作-對(duì)變化的適應(yīng)性強(qiáng)挑戰(zhàn):-需要嚴(yán)格的時(shí)間盒管理-產(chǎn)品負(fù)責(zé)人需投入大量精力-團(tuán)隊(duì)自組織需要文化建設(shè)-長(zhǎng)期項(xiàng)目中的Sprint切換可能造成上下文切換成本Kanban方法詳解Kanban的基本概念Kanban(看板)源自豐田生產(chǎn)方式,是一種可視化工作管理方法。Kanban通過限制在制品(WorkinProgress,WIP)數(shù)量,優(yōu)化工作流,減少浪費(fèi)。與Scrum不同,Kanban沒有固定的周期和角色,更像是一種持續(xù)改進(jìn)的過程。Kanban的核心要素包括:1.象限(Columns):代表工作流程的不同階段2.看板(Board):可視化工作流的可視化展示3.WIP限制:控制每個(gè)階段同時(shí)進(jìn)行的工作數(shù)量4.流量度量:跟蹤工作流效率的指標(biāo)Kanban的實(shí)施要點(diǎn)工作流可視化Kanban的核心是可視化。團(tuán)隊(duì)將工作流程劃分為幾個(gè)關(guān)鍵階段(如"請(qǐng)求"、"開發(fā)"、"測(cè)試"、"完成"),在每個(gè)階段設(shè)置WIP限制。工作項(xiàng)以卡片形式在看板上移動(dòng),直觀展示進(jìn)度和瓶頸。WIP限制WIP限制是Kanban的關(guān)鍵實(shí)踐。通過限制每個(gè)階段的在制品數(shù)量,可以迫使團(tuán)隊(duì)優(yōu)先完成當(dāng)前任務(wù),避免多任務(wù)并行導(dǎo)致的效率下降。WIP限制需要根據(jù)實(shí)際數(shù)據(jù)確定,并通過持續(xù)觀察調(diào)整。流量度量Kanban通過多個(gè)度量指標(biāo)監(jiān)控工作流效率:-流動(dòng)效率:完成工作所需時(shí)間-周期時(shí)間:從開始到完成的工作時(shí)間-吞吐量:?jiǎn)挝粫r(shí)間內(nèi)完成的工作數(shù)量-延遲:工作等待時(shí)間這些度量幫助團(tuán)隊(duì)識(shí)別瓶頸,持續(xù)改進(jìn)流程。持續(xù)改進(jìn)Kanban強(qiáng)調(diào)持續(xù)改進(jìn)(Kaizen)。團(tuán)隊(duì)定期回顧工作流,通過"回顧會(huì)議"討論哪些環(huán)節(jié)可以優(yōu)化,調(diào)整WIP限制、流程階段或工作方法。改進(jìn)措施通常采用"快速實(shí)驗(yàn)"的方式,小步快跑地迭代。Kanban的優(yōu)勢(shì)與挑戰(zhàn)優(yōu)勢(shì):-靈活適應(yīng)不同項(xiàng)目規(guī)模和類型-持續(xù)改進(jìn)文化促進(jìn)長(zhǎng)期優(yōu)化-可與其他敏捷方法結(jié)合使用-對(duì)團(tuán)隊(duì)結(jié)構(gòu)要求低挑戰(zhàn):-需要較強(qiáng)的流程意識(shí)-WIP限制的初始設(shè)定較難-缺乏Scrum的固定節(jié)奏-需要持續(xù)的數(shù)據(jù)跟蹤和分析Scrum與Kanban的比較核心差異|特征|Scrum|Kanban|||--|||周期|固定Sprint周期(1-4周)|持續(xù)流動(dòng)||角色|明確定義(PO,SM,DevTeam)|無(wú)固定角色||計(jì)劃方式|Sprint計(jì)劃會(huì)確定范圍和目標(biāo)|持續(xù)拉動(dòng)||交付方式|每個(gè)Sprint交付增量|持續(xù)交付||WIP限制|每個(gè)Sprint內(nèi)隱式限制|顯式WIP限制貫穿始終||變化管理|Sprint期間范圍相對(duì)固定|可隨時(shí)調(diào)整|適用場(chǎng)景Scrum更適合:-需要明確迭代目標(biāo)和交付周期的大型項(xiàng)目-新產(chǎn)品開發(fā)或需要快速驗(yàn)證想法的場(chǎng)景-團(tuán)隊(duì)規(guī)模適中(5-10人)的跨職能團(tuán)隊(duì)Kanban更適合:-現(xiàn)有流程需要優(yōu)化的成熟團(tuán)隊(duì)-任務(wù)類型多樣且不確定的項(xiàng)目-團(tuán)隊(duì)規(guī)模較大或結(jié)構(gòu)復(fù)雜的組織結(jié)合使用許多團(tuán)隊(duì)在實(shí)踐中結(jié)合Scrum和Kanban的優(yōu)點(diǎn):-使用Scrum進(jìn)行大型項(xiàng)目劃分,每個(gè)子項(xiàng)目采用Kanban管理-在Scrum框架內(nèi)使用Kanban看板可視化SprintBacklog-將Kanban的WIP限制引入Scrum開發(fā)過程敏捷方法的實(shí)施要點(diǎn)文化建設(shè)敏捷成功的關(guān)鍵在于文化建設(shè):-鼓勵(lì)團(tuán)隊(duì)自組織和協(xié)作-建立心理安全感,允許犯錯(cuò)和學(xué)習(xí)-促進(jìn)跨職能溝通和知識(shí)共享-推動(dòng)持續(xù)改進(jìn)的思維方式領(lǐng)導(dǎo)力支持管理層需要:-理解并支持敏捷價(jià)值觀-授予團(tuán)隊(duì)實(shí)際決策權(quán)-避免微觀管理-提供必要的資源和支持工具選擇合適的工具可以提升敏捷實(shí)踐效率:-產(chǎn)品待辦事項(xiàng)管理工具(如Jira,Trello)-每日站會(huì)計(jì)時(shí)器-Sprint評(píng)審會(huì)演示工具-Kanban可視化看板軟件-流量度量分析工具適應(yīng)與調(diào)整敏捷不是一成不變的框架,需要根據(jù)實(shí)際情況調(diào)整:-初期可以從簡(jiǎn)化的敏捷實(shí)踐開始-定期回顧效果,持續(xù)優(yōu)化-結(jié)合組織文化和業(yè)務(wù)特點(diǎn)定制方法-保持對(duì)敏捷原則的持續(xù)學(xué)習(xí)和實(shí)踐敏捷開發(fā)的未來(lái)趨勢(shì)隨著數(shù)字化轉(zhuǎn)型深入,敏捷開發(fā)持續(xù)演進(jìn):-敏捷與DevOps結(jié)合,實(shí)現(xiàn)持續(xù)交付-敏捷在人工智能、大數(shù)據(jù)等新興領(lǐng)域的應(yīng)用-敏捷治理框架的建立,平衡靈活性與合規(guī)性-敏捷方法的規(guī)?;瘜?shí)施和組織變革管理-敏捷思維的普及,從軟件開發(fā)擴(kuò)展到其他業(yè)務(wù)領(lǐng)域結(jié)論Scrum和Kanban作為兩種主流敏捷方法,各有獨(dú)特的優(yōu)勢(shì)和應(yīng)用場(chǎng)景。Scrum通過固定周期的迭代提供結(jié)構(gòu)化的開發(fā)節(jié)奏,而Kanban則通過可視化工作流和WIP
溫馨提示
- 1. 本站所有資源如無(wú)特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 2026年上半年黑龍江事業(yè)單位聯(lián)考省委辦公廳招聘6人備考考試試題附答案解析
- 2026江西南昌市勞動(dòng)保障事務(wù)代理中心外包項(xiàng)目招聘2人備考考試題庫(kù)附答案解析
- 第14章 回歸:走向自主創(chuàng)新的中國(guó)公共行政學(xué)
- 2026年吉安吉星養(yǎng)老服務(wù)有限公司招聘護(hù)理員參考考試題庫(kù)附答案解析
- 2026上海應(yīng)物所財(cái)務(wù)與資產(chǎn)處副處長(zhǎng)競(jìng)聘1人備考考試試題附答案解析
- 2026中國(guó)科學(xué)院理化技術(shù)研究所熱聲熱機(jī)團(tuán)隊(duì)招聘特別研究助理博士后1人備考考試試題附答案解析
- 武漢市漢陽(yáng)區(qū)晴川英才初級(jí)中學(xué)招聘教師2人參考考試題庫(kù)附答案解析
- 2026浙江溫州市平陽(yáng)縣消防救援大隊(duì)廚師招聘1人參考考試試題附答案解析
- 2026山東德州市事業(yè)單位招聘初級(jí)綜合類崗位人員備考考試題庫(kù)附答案解析
- 2026年安陽(yáng)市中心血站招聘勞務(wù)派遣人員4名備考考試試題附答案解析
- 酒店餐飲營(yíng)銷管理制度內(nèi)容(3篇)
- 林業(yè)執(zhí)法案件課件
- 卵巢囊腫蒂扭轉(zhuǎn)治療課件
- 十四五規(guī)劃試題及答案
- 篩分設(shè)備安裝施工詳細(xì)方案
- 2025-2026學(xué)年高三上學(xué)期10月階段性教學(xué)質(zhì)量評(píng)估語(yǔ)文試卷及參考答案
- 2025年低空經(jīng)濟(jì)行業(yè)災(zāi)害應(yīng)急演練與評(píng)估報(bào)告
- 煤礦崗位風(fēng)險(xiǎn)知識(shí)培訓(xùn)課件
- 2025年新疆第師圖木舒克市公安招聘警務(wù)輔助人員公共基礎(chǔ)知識(shí)+寫作自測(cè)試題及答案解析
- 《現(xiàn)代推銷學(xué)》市場(chǎng)營(yíng)銷專業(yè)全套教學(xué)課件
- 綠色交通系統(tǒng)1000輛新能源公交車推廣可行性研究報(bào)告
評(píng)論
0/150
提交評(píng)論